Therapeutic approaches and online care
Jason Brooker draws on Client-Centered Therapy to prioritise the client's perspective, offering a listening-based approach that helps people feel understood and supported while they explore personal concerns.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, or CBT, is used to identify and change unhelpful thinking and behaviour patterns and can be especially useful for anxiety, depression, and stress-related difficulties. He also integrates Trauma-Focused Therapy when past distress is central to a person’s difficulties, working gently to process traumatic experiences and reduce their ongoing impact.Finding the right approach is part of the therapeutic process. As a registered professional, Jason works collaboratively with each person to decide which methods best match their needs, goals, and preferences, and adjusts the plan as progress unfolds.
Online therapy with Jason is offered via video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or text-based messaging, providing flexibility for different schedules and communication styles. These options make it easier to fit therapy into everyday life and to continue work between sessions, while enabling therapists and clients to maintain continuity of care regardless of location.
